What Stem Cell Therapy Can Do for Back Pain
Stem cell therapy targets degenerative or inflamed spinal tissues, promoting natural healing where traditional treatments may fall short. It’s frequently considered for conditions such as degenerative disc disease, facet joint pain, chronic ligament strain, and lingering pain from past injuries.
Unlike steroid injections that provide short-lived relief, regenerative treatments work gradually to repair tissue over time.
Essential Safety Questions to Ask at Your Consultation
During your consultation in Morgantown, be sure to ask:
- What spinal issue is causing my pain? A precise diagnosis using imaging helps ensure stem cell therapy is appropriate.
- Will the procedure use ultrasound or fluoroscopic guidance? Image-guided precision is critical for safe, accurate placement.
- What risks should I be aware of? Most patients experience mild soreness or stiffness, but your doctor should review all potential risks based on your condition.
- How long until I may see results? Healing is gradual, typically developing over weeks to months.
- What are the alternatives if I’m not a candidate? A responsible provider will offer multiple pathways, not just one option.
